Flying in the face of gloomy world politics, the art world was in high spirits on Wednesday at the opening of Frieze in Regent’s Park, where supermodels, including the German beauty Claudia Schiffer, and super-curators rubbed shoulders with the usual crowd of international artists and art enthusiasts. Purse strings were being loosened, too. Wissam Al Mana, the co-owner of Lazinc gallery and former husband of Janet Jackson, said healready had his eye on “a few pieces”. But by the end of the day, another fair-goer was overheard saying: “We might as well go to get something to eat; it’s not as if we can afford any more art.”
